Summary of the comparison
Enfield County School for Girls and Highlands School are secondary schools.
Enfield County School for Girls scores 64 out of 100 (grade C, average) and Highlands School scores 75 out of 100 (grade B, strong). Highlands School is ahead on our composite score.
Enfield County School for Girls was judged Good and Highlands School was judged exceptional.
On GCSE Attainment 8, the latest published figures are 52.0 for Enfield County School for Girls and 55.5 for Highlands School.
GCSE Attainment 8 has fallen at Enfield County School for Girls (58.7 in 2021-22, 52.0 in 2024-25) and has risen at Highlands School (53.2 in 2021-22, 55.5 in 2024-25).
